Core Viewpoint - The Southern Transitional Council (STC) of Yemen has initiated a series of security and governance measures aimed at resolving political issues in the southern region and contributing to regional stability [1][3]. Group 1: Political Developments - The STC announced a two-year "transitional phase" to facilitate dialogue between the north and south, culminating in a public referendum on the future status of the south under UN supervision [3]. - The STC's statement highlighted that the southern population has begun to take control of local security and governance to prevent resource loss and restore normal governance [3]. - The establishment of the "transitional phase" aims to avoid new conflicts, ensure a safe and orderly political process, and protect southern interests while reducing the costs of regional instability [3][4]. Group 2: Economic and Social Measures - The STC called for national institutions to normalize social life during the transitional period, ensuring public services and salary payments, while emphasizing the need to standardize financial revenue management under the central bank in Aden [3]. - The STC expressed willingness to communicate with northern "national forces" to negotiate arrangements during the transitional period based on common interests, while continuing to support northern forces against the Houthi movement and promoting the reconstruction of national institutions [3].
